Background
In June 2019, an extradition bill was proposed in Hong Kong whereby, many were against the
bill and protested against it. Due to the misunderstandings, the tourist attraction of the city was
affected and it reduced the productivity of the industry. Indeed, the numbers of the protestors
increased thus turned to civil insubordination and revolutionary actions including distracting
airport operations, public transport and causing extensive strikes. Consequently due to the
mushrooming violence, the international media houses re- announced Hong Kong as a hazardous
city and thus visitors from other countries ought to be cautious and seek travel advisories. In
addition, Hong Kong was also stated as the dangerous city and thus not safe for visits.

In hong kong tourism is recognized as an economic pillar. However, the protests affected the
economic sector which led to a drop of arrivals in the city. Despite the rapid growth of arrivals
in june 2019, the tourism board of Hong Kong releases the latest figures from July 2019,
showing a drop of arrivals by 4.8% compared to the last year’s record. Although, from January
to July the city has recorded 11.1% increased growth of the arrivals.
Indeed the number of arrivals decreased as the year goes by; thus in August 2019 the arrivals
reduced by 40% comparing to the last year’s figures. Surprisingly people make early
arrangements while traveling, however the drastic events have affect the optimal bookings of the
destination. Therefore the city is hoping that the arrivals will increase before the year ends;
certainly it is not possible even when the protest ceases. Besides, the revenue sales in the hotel
rooms in the city have reduced by 50 % and still the hotels have reduced in the occupancy.
Additionally, the retail sectors for shopping by tourist who are the target have also been affected
by the situation.
Mainland china is the target market for tourist in Hong Kong Pang et al. (2019 p.1-24).
Therefore, over the past five years, approximately, 80 % of visitors were from the mainland
china Su et al. (2019 p.1-17). Besides from January to July around 32millions of visitors from
mainland visited Hong Kong at least four times compared to other countries. Besides, the
mainland visitors are known for spending more capital in Hong Kong compared to other
countries that visits the city whereby, the data shows that in the year 2018 every over night
visitor from mainland china spends a quarter more money than any other visitor other countries.
Additionally, the mainland visitor spends three times more money compared from other visitors
from different countries.

Economic sustainability tourism in Hong Kong
Among the Asians cities, Hong Kong is recognized as the crowded city but it also leads in
cleanliness. However the city is also affected by the environmental pollutions including; the air
pollution, fueled industries from mainland china and the vehicle traffic. Besides, according to the
research the pollution worsens and it therefore affects the weather predictions.
Despite the drastic environmental issues, the city try to improve inbeing economical thus reduce
the global challenges. Therefore, Hong Kong strategizes on using a nonstop flight since less fuel
will be consumed compared to the indirect flights that keeps on stopping by and then takes off.
Additionally the destination plans their trips during the day whereby, according to the science
research, during the night, the flights are more harmful to the environment. Additionally, the
tourism sectors at Hong Kong advices the visitors to carry a light luggage to emit the carbon
dioxide.
In hong Kong public transport is more efficient and convenient compared to taxi Thereby the
buses, ferries, and trains are the preferred means of transport. Although, taking a walk is also
healthy thus stay more fit and healthy and reduce the zero emissions.
